What is a winter safety initative?
Quote:
DUE TO A WINTER SAFETY INITIATIVE, ALL RIDERS CARRIED AN ADDITIONAL TWO POUNDS
|
This footnote appeared in the chart notes for races #6-9 at Aqu today.
Anyone know what it means? What safety effect wouls 2 lbs have?

Many states/racing commissions have this policy buried in their rules and regulations:
...Upon approval by the board of stewards or their designee, jockeys may be allowed up to two pounds more than published weights to account for inclement weather clothing and equipment...
